San Bernardino Man Arrested for Sex Crimes Against a Child

SAN BERNARDINO – (VVNG.COM): A 37-year-old man from San Bernardino has been arrested for sex crimes against a child and Detectives fear there ma be more victims.

On September 25, 2014, at approximately 8:57 p.m., Deputy Bernabe Ortiz responded to the 2300 block of W. Ogden Avenue in San Bernardino following the report of Sex Crimes Against a Child.

According to authorities, after conducting his initial investigation, Ortiz determined the suspect, identified as Armando Gamez-Lopez was responsible for several related crimes and discovered an additional 2 more juvenile victims. Gamez-Lopez was later located and arrested without incident. He was booked at the West Valley Detention Center of $250,000 bail for PC 288(a) Lewd and Lascivious Acts upon a child under the age of 14, and PC 286.5 Sexual Assault on an Animal.

Deputies suspect there may be additional victims related to this investigation.
